Before you even go that far, do you have the correct seals on the drain and fill plug AND the dipstick? The reason I ask is when I bought my boat last year the dip S*%T previous owner had the wrong seal on the dip stick and who knows when the last time he changed the O rings on the drain and fill plugs.
We were test driving the boat, I go to look over the back while under way and I see green oil coming out from around the dip stick. He says "oh, must not have tightened the dip stick all the way". The guy had a green square shoulder seal like what you would find in an OMC lower unit, when he should have had an actual O ring. Consequently I had a bunch of water in the oil. Installed correct O rings and no more water in the oil.
That said, I would probably get your bellows changed out as well.
